George Washington Memorial Broadside Unrecorded Printed Upon Paper
January 1, 1800-Dated, Unique Paper Broadside Memorial Poem entitled, “An Elegiac Poem on the Death of George Washington Commander in Chief of the Armies of the United States.,” Printed by “R. AITKEN,” Fine.
This Unique original, Printed Broadside measures 11.5" x 18" and was issued in the wake of George Washington's death, this version being upon heavy period paper. The poem itself is written in three columns and displayed within a pediment and arch, having an ornate Funeral Urn vignette atop both the right and left side fancy typeset border designs. It was printed very shortly after Washington's death, on January 1, 1800, by R. Aitken. Another example is known on silk and is listed in "Threads of History" reference book as #18.

This Broadside is Unrecorded as being printed upon paper. It is previously Unknown, possibly “Unique,” and a major rarity as such. There is a long 4” sealed tear and area of heavy toning at the left central edge with trivial scattered pinholes, still complete and sound. Written in brown ink, in large fancy manuscript form, upon the blank reverse side is, “An Elegiac Poem on the Death of General George Washington Commander and Chief of the United States of,” being very close to, but not using exactly the same text, as the title of the printed poem. Some of the reverse being within the toning area and there harder to read.

Absolutely authentic, having been actually used, the evidence showing as four small holes at the corners being direct evidence of a previous posting. The classic poem portion is written in three vertical columns.
